Fire resistance tests on circular concrete columns

The fire resistance of these columns is probably more compromised than in circular columns due to the phenomenon of concrete detachment in the corners of the cross-section. In order to examine the influence of several parameters on the behaviour in fire of circular reinforced concrete columns with restrained thermal elongation, several fire resistance tests were carried out. The parameters tested were load, restraint level, slenderness of the column and the longitudinal reinforcement ratio. In the fire resistance tests the specimens were exposed to the ISO 834 Standard fire curve and the critical time and temperature and failure modes were determined. The test results mainly indicated that the spalling phenomenon may also occur in circular columns and so reducing its fire resistance. The restrained level might not so much relevant concerning the fire resistance of circular reinforced concrete columns.zeige mehrzeige weniger
